Lecture on the Eight Priority Areas of Renewed Hope Agenda by Barr. (Mrs.) Uche Chikwem of the Central Results Delivery Coordination Unit (CRDCU)
The Lecture centered on the Ministerial deliverables of the Renewed Hope Agenda of Mr.President, which is made up of eight priority areas .
Barr. Uche Chikwem highlighted these Eight Presidential Priorities and Ministerial Key Deliverables and discussed how progress review, challenges, and strategies are set to help the NBC refine its approach and improve on key performance areas identified, which will also help navigate the challenges that have been identified so far.
She further narrowed down the Commission’s Deliverables to five, which includes:
– Regulatory Frameworks: Developing and implementing effective regulatory frameworks for the broadcasting industry.
– Content Standards: Ensuring broadcasting content meets certain standards and guidelines.
– Industry Monitoring: Monitoring the broadcasting industry for compliance with regulations and standards.
– Capacity Building: Building capacity within the NBC and the industry to ensure effective service delivery to the public.
In conclusion the facilitator did a Progress Review on the Commission, where the Commission’s progress in achieving its deliverables were reviewed.
She identified challenges and obstacles in implementing the deliverables and further recommended strategies for better results and improved performance.
